- W2076480212 abstract "A microtechnique for determining the superoxide dismutase activity in erythrocytes is described. This technique involves the inhibition of luminol-enhanced chemiluminescence of superoxide anion generated by xanthine-xanthine oxidase. Measurements required a steady-state chemiluminescence whether superoxide dismutase was present or absent; the level of luminescence was correlated to enzyme activity. Superoxide dismutase activity measured by this technique was 836 ± 112 μg/g of hemoglobin for whole blood and 834 ± 109 μg/g of hemoglobin for erythrocytes. When the reference technique was applied to larger amounts of blood, the results were 862 ± 58 and 858 ± 116 μg/g of hemoglobin for whole blood and washed erythrocytes, respectively. The enzymatic activity of superoxide dismutase from fetal blood (obtained by venipuncture in utero and of 19–26 weeks gestational age) was similar to that of adult blood, when measured by the new technique." @default.
